Try turning dosbox machine - vga to dosbox machine - cga If they're text based this will make _no_ difference - vga and cga text modes are identical. Perhaps you might try even lower like MGA or hercules.(it might look a bit different tho ) I'm quite sure that ADOM requires VGA. I spent the better …
